The Crypto Company reported its financial results for the first quarter of 2026, revealing a revenue increase to $4.0 million, up from $2.9 million in the same period last year. This 42% rise in revenue is attributed to heightened demand for the company's blockchain training services. Despite the revenue growth, the company recorded a net loss of $171,822, a significant improvement compared to a loss of $611,582 in the first quarter of 2025. The loss per share remained at $(0.00) for both periods, reflecting the company's ongoing challenges in achieving profitability.
In terms of operational metrics, general and administrative expenses surged to $738,896 in Q1 2026, compared to $319,943 in Q1 2025. This increase is primarily due to higher costs associated with professional services and payroll. The company also reported a notable shift in other income, which amounted to $581,249 in Q1 2026, compared to an expense of $135,695 in the prior year. This change was largely driven by a reduction in derivative liabilities following the restructuring of convertible notes, which also contributed to a decrease in interest expenses.
The company’s balance sheet as of March 31, 2026, showed total assets of $33.4 million, a significant decline from $221 million at the end of 2025. This decrease was primarily due to a reduction in cryptocurrency holdings, which fell from $123.8 million to $18.5 million. Current liabilities were reported at $6.1 million, slightly down from $6.3 million at the end of the previous fiscal year. The accumulated deficit increased to $56.9 million, reflecting the ongoing financial challenges faced by the company.
Strategically, The Crypto Company has made significant moves, including the acquisition of the "Frame" blockchain business through an Asset Purchase Agreement executed on March 20, 2026. This acquisition includes various assets such as intellectual property and software repositories, with the company committing to fund at least $2 million for further development of these assets. The company is also exploring various financing strategies to support its operations and meet its obligations, as it currently faces a working capital deficit of approximately $6.1 million.
Looking ahead, The Crypto Company acknowledges the competitive and rapidly changing environment of the blockchain and cryptocurrency markets. The management is focused on generating profitable operations and securing necessary financing to sustain its business model. However, the company has expressed concerns regarding its ability to continue as a going concern, given its history of losses and the current financial condition. The management is actively pursuing various strategies to address these challenges, although no financing commitments have been secured as of the date of the report.

About 10-Q Filings
A 10-Q form is an important financial report that public companies in the United States must submit every three months. It gives a clear picture of a company's financial health and recent performance.
Key points about the 10-Q:
- Frequency: Companies file it three times a year, covering the first three quarters. The fourth quarter is covered in a more comprehensive annual report.
-
Content: It includes:
- Financial statements showing the company's current financial position
- Updates from management on the performance and projections of the business
- Information about potential risks the company faces
- Details on how the company is run internally
- Deadline: Must be filed within 40 or 45 days after the quarter ends, depending on the size of the company.
